About the role: Nightfall is expanding its endpoint Data Loss Prevention (DLP) coverage to Linux, and we are looking for a seasoned Endpoint Engineer to lead this effort. You will be at the ground level of building Linux agent capabilities from the ground up, working alongside our existing Mac and Windows endpoint teams. As an Endpoint Engineer (Linux) at Nightfall, you will design, build, and maintain a production-grade, AI-native DLP agent for Linux - covering kernel-level event interception, userspace policy enforcement, and enterprise deployment. This role requires deep Linux systems expertise and the drive to own a strategic new platform for the company. RESPONSIBILITIES - Design and develop data exfiltration prevention applications, kernel modules, system services, and agents on Linux. - Build and maintain mission-critical endpoint agents that monitor and enforce DLP policies across Linux distributions (Ubuntu, RHEL/CentOS, and others). - Implement kernel-level event interception using eBPF, LSM hooks, netfilter, fanotify, or similar mechanisms to monitor file, network, and clipboard activity. - Develop userspace components that integrate with kernel subsystems and enforce policy decisions in real time. - Collaborate closely with the Mac and Windows endpoint teams to align on cross-platform agent architecture, shared policy models, and consistent DLP behaviors. - Own complex features from design to delivery - including scoping, implementation, testing, and customer-facing documentation. - Diagnose and resolve deep systems-level issues including kernel panics, race conditions, file descriptor leaks, and IPC failures. - Ensure agent reliability, upgrade safety, and minimal performance footprint on target Linux environments. - Write and maintain documentation covering internal architecture, public APIs, and deployment guides for enterprise customers.
